Output eca1d705a258f19cbf8a2aece9c687cf768139683768e02385f02583988671df:1

value
41380238
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0fba01effadd5adaf4605797bae2f10ca0f389d9 OP_EQUAL
address
338AtTGCnxTYYz1mtAGGHPUKimmPqjUdDD
transaction
eca1d705a258f19cbf8a2aece9c687cf768139683768e02385f02583988671df
confirmations
398010
spent
true